Understanding Door Jamb Seals: An Essential Guide

Door jamb seals play a crucial role in maintaining the stability and efficiency of residential and commercial spaces. They serve as barriers versus various external elements such as weather, noise, and bugs while also supplying a finished aim to your doors. This article will dive into the significance, types, setup, and maintenance of door jamb seals, in addition to a thorough FAQ section.

What are Door Jamb Seals?

Door jamb seals are products placed around the door frame (jamb) where the door meets the frame. replacement roofs northampton is to create a tight seal that avoids air, moisture, and sound from penetrating into or leaving from the interior space. A well-installed door jamb seal can lead to enhanced energy effectiveness, lowered sound pollution, and a more comfy living environment.

Kinds Of Door Jamb Seals

There are several types of door jamb seals available, each created for specific applications. Below is a detailed overview of the most typical types:

Type

Product

Setup Method

Best Used For

Weatherstripping

Foam, rubber, vinyl

Adhesive or nails

External doors to minimize drafts

Door Sweep

Aluminum, rubber

Screwed or adhesive

Bottom of doors to block spaces

Acoustic Seal

Dense foam

Adhesive

Soundproofing interior doors

Magnetic Seal

Magnetic strips

Press-fit

Fridge and closet doors

Threshold Seal

Rubber, vinyl

Mounted with screws

Entry points to block drafts

Installation of Door Jamb Seals

Installing door jamb seals can be a straightforward DIY job. Here's a step-by-step guide for house owners seeking to set up weatherstripping:

Materials Needed:

  • Weatherstripping material (foam, rubber, or adhesive)
  • Scissors or utility knife
  • Determining tape
  • Cleaning supplies (for surface preparation)
  • Adhesive or nails (if not self-adhesive)

Steps:

  1. Measure the Door Frame: Use a determining tape to accurately figure out the dimensions of the door frame. Step both height and width.
  2. Pick the Right Seal: Depending on your requirements (weather, noise, etc), pick a suitable seal type.
  3. Clean the Surface: Wipe down the door frame where the seal will be applied. A tidy surface ensures much better adhesion.
  4. Cut the Seal to Size: Using scissors or an energy knife, cut the weatherstripping material to match your measurements.
  5. Apply the Seal: If using adhesive, carefully put the seal along the frame, guaranteeing it is straight and even. For nails, place the seal in place and secure it utilizing the suitable fasteners.
  6. Test the Door: Open and close the door to ensure it seals appropriately and doesn't block the motion. Change as required.

Maintenance of Door Jamb Seals

To maximize the efficiency of door jamb seals, routine upkeep is important. Here are a couple of tips:

  1. Inspect Regularly: Check for indications of wear, tears, or detachment. Conduct evaluations at least when a year.
  2. Clean the Seals: Regularly tidy the seals with a damp fabric to remove dirt and debris that might impact efficiency.
  3. Reposition or Replace: If seals are coming loose or harmed, reposition or replace them immediately.
  4. Seasonal Checks: Special attention needs to be provided before severe weather condition modifications. Guarantee seals are undamaged before winter season and summertime seasons.

Frequently Asked Question About Door Jamb Seals

1. What is the very best material for door jamb seals?

The very best material depends on the application. Foam and rubber are exceptional for weather condition resistance, while dense foam is ideal for soundproofing.

2. How long do door jamb seals last?

The life-span of door jamb seals can differ widely based upon the product and environmental conditions. Usually, they can last anywhere from 1 to 10 years.

3. Can I set up door jamb seals myself?

Yes, a lot of door jamb seals are created for simple DIY installation. Simply ensure you have the right tools and materials.

4. Are door jamb seals effective in sound reduction?

Yes, seals are particularly effective at blocking noise when matched with acoustic door seals, creating a quieter environment.

5. How do I understand if my door jamb seals require replacing?

Signs consist of visible wear, drafts, increased energy expenses, or difficulty in opening and closing the door.
